Ghost Writer
Devon Gillespie 1988 (Florida)
Write! He encourages
Write of my love for you
Of early morning coffee shops
Of daydreams but for two
Write! He requests of me
Of misty evening trails
Write of a love so pure and strong
We though it'd never fail
Write! He begs insistently
Our twilight turns to dusk!
Write to keep the night at bay
Write, save us, you must!
Write! His requirement
Write through the misty haze
Write though you're battle-worn and weary
Write past the bitter days
Write! He commands of me
Write though your hand is aching
Write of the pain that spills from you
Write as your heart is breaking
Write! Prove your worth, he yells
Write through the tears that fall
Write haikus, prose, and limericks
Write, poet, write them all
Write! The words he rips from me
Write so the world can see!
Write of everything you've ever lost
Write one last ode to me!
Write, he whispers quietly
Write 'til the ink runs dry
Write, feel your muscles seize
Write until you die
About this poem
The poem, written in 2016, describes the hopelessness the writer feels as she clings to the last request her lover made of her before leaving.
